Abstract
The LabVIEW state diagram toolkit can be used to design and implement state machines within the LabVIEW development environment. The toolkit includes a state diagram editor so the user can draw the logic that defines the state machine. As this visual representation of the logic is created, the state diagram editor generates the LabVIEW code that executes the state machine. The logic is represented in code by a series of graphical while loops and case statements. The generated LabVIEW code can run on multiple operating systems and multiple real-time targets including NI programmable automation controller (PAC) platforms such as PXI/cPCI, CompactRIO, and Compact FieldPoint
